By Daniel A. Menasce, Lawrence W. Dowdy, Virgilio A.F. Almeida

Functional structures modeling: making plans functionality, availability, safety, and moreComputing structures needs to meet more and more strict caliber of provider (QoS) necessities for functionality, availability, defense, and maintainability. to accomplish those targets, designers, analysts, and capability planners desire a way more thorough figuring out of QoS concerns, and the consequences in their judgements. Now, 3 major specialists current a whole, application-driven framework for knowing and estimating functionality. you will study precisely easy methods to map real-life structures to exact functionality versions, and use these versions to make higher judgements - either up entrance and in the course of the complete procedure lifecycle. assurance contains: * cutting-edge quantitative research options, supported via broad numerical examples and workouts * QoS concerns in requisites research, specification, layout, improvement, checking out, deployment, operation, and approach evolution * particular situations, together with e-Business and database prone, servers, clusters, and information facilities * concepts for picking capability congestion at either software program and degrees * functionality Engineering suggestions and instruments * unique resolution thoughts together with precise and approximate MVA and Markov Chains * Modeling of software program rivalry, fork-and-join, provider cost variability, and precedence

Show description

Read Online or Download Performance by Design: Computer Capacity Planning by Example PDF

Best city planning & urban development books

Landscape Amenities: Economic Assessment of Agricultural Landscapes (Landscape Series, Vol. 2)

This e-book maps issues of universal realizing and cooperation within the interpretation of landscapes. those interfaces look among cultures, among traditional and human sciences, lay humans and specialists, time and area, protection and use, ecology and semiosis. The publication compares how varied cultures interpret landscapes, examines how cultural values are assessed, explores new instruments for review, strains the dialogue approximately panorama authenticity, and eventually attracts views for extra learn.

Climate Resilient Cities: A Primer on Reducing Vulnerabilities to Disasters

'Climate Resilient towns: A Primer on decreasing Vulnerabilities to mess ups' presents urban administratorswith precisely what they should learn about the complicated and compelling demanding situations of weather swap. The publication is helping neighborhood governments create education, capability construction, and capital funding courses for development sustainable, resilient groups.

Sustainable brownfield regeneration: liveable places from problem spaces

Sustainable Brownfield Regeneration provides a finished account of united kingdom regulations, procedures and practices in brownfield regeneration and takes an built-in and theoretically-grounded method of spotlight top perform. Brownfield regeneration has turn into an incredible coverage motive force in constructed international locations.

Port Management and Operations

"This e-book was once written with the aim of redefining the strategic position of world seaports within the current "Post-New financial system period. " Ports are those extraordinary human structures that over centuries replicate the epitome of worldwide evolution, fiscal development, and innovation. As 70. eight% of the worldwide floor is roofed by way of water, seaports replicate all sovereign international locations' political superiority and fiscal prosperity.

Extra resources for Performance by Design: Computer Capacity Planning by Example

Sample text

The service demands do not include any queuing time, only the total service required by a transaction at the device. , as the throughput, X0) increases on the database server, each of the device utilizations also increases linearly as a function of their individual Di's. See Fig. 6. As indicated in the figure, the utilization of disk 3 will reach 100% before any other resource, because the utilization of this disk is always greater than that of other resources. That is, disk3 is the system's bottleneck.

1. Closed QN model of a database server. 1. , the sum of the number of reads and writes per second. This value is indicated in the fourth column of the table. Using the Utilization Law, the average service time is computed as Si as Ui/Xi. 0108 sec. 8 tps. 2 Service Demand Law Service demand is a fundamental concept in performance modeling. The notion of service demand is associated both with a resource and a set of requests using the resource. The service demand, denoted as Di, is defined as the total average time spent by a typical request of a given type obtaining service from resource i.

A QN is a collection of K interconnected queues. A queue includes the waiting line and the resource that provides service to customers. Customers move from one queue to the other until they complete their execution and may be grouped into one or more customer classes. In some cases, customers may be allowed to switch to other classes when they move between queues. A QN can be open, closed, or mixed depending on its customer classes: open if all classes are open, closed if all classes are closed, and mixed if some classes are open and some are closed.

Download PDF sample

Rated 4.23 of 5 – based on 13 votes